This lesson is aligned with TEKS - 4th Grade Mathematics.
- TEKS Math 4.4C: Represent the product of 2 two-digit numbers using arrays, area models, or equations, including perfect squares through 15 by 15;

24 Questions:
- A gardener plants 12 rows of daisies with 14 daisies in each row. Which equation represents the total number of daisies?
- A spring seed bed is shown as a rectangle with side lengths split into 10 + 3 and 10 + 5. Which set of partial products matches the area model?
- Emma arranges 13 potted tulips into 12 equal rows for the spring fair. Which array matches the situation?
- A square flower patch has side lengths of 11 feet. Which equation shows its area?
- At a spring picnic, 15 tables each have 12 flower cookies. Which expression represents the total number of cookies?
- A rectangular garden measures 12 feet by 16 feet. Which equation could be best used to find the area with partial products?
- Noah uses an area model for 13 × 14. One part is 10 × 10. Which other three parts should be included?
- Which expanded form can be used to represent 13 × 15?
- Which multiplication sentence shows a perfect square?
- Olivia is making a rectangular butterfly grid with 15 rows and 13 columns. How many spaces are in the grid?
- A student says 14 × 12 can be represented as (10 × 10) + (10 × 2) + (4 × 10) + (4 × 2). What is the product?
- Which area model correctly represents 12 × 13?
- A square stepping-stone path has 14 stones on each side. Which equation shows the total number of stones in the array?
- A farmer places 11 trays of seedlings in each of 14 greenhouse rows. Which equation best represents the arrangement?
- Which expression uses the distributive property to represent 13 × 12?
- Which set of partial products can be added to find 15 × 12?
- Ava makes a square herb garden with side lengths of 15 feet. What is the area?
- A spring art class makes 10 rows of flower cards with 13 cards in each row. Which picture description matches this product?
- Which equation below represents the same product as a 14-by-11 array?
- A seed catalog page shows 13 packets across and 15 packets down. Which total should be found?
- A rectangle is broken apart to show 12 × 14. Which sum of partial products is correct?
- Sophia says a square garden with side lengths of 10 feet is a perfect square model. Why is she correct?
- A garden shop packs 12 seed bundles in each crate and stacks 11 crates. About how many seed bundles are packed in all?
- Which equation would help solve this spring problem: “There are 13 rows of flowers, and each row has 13 flowers”?
